28、生成式AI应用开发与部署指南

生成式AI应用开发与部署指南

在当今数字化时代,生成式AI应用的开发与部署成为了众多开发者关注的焦点。本文将详细介绍生成式AI应用开发与部署的相关知识,包括敏感信息处理、GitHub部署、云平台部署等方面,帮助开发者更好地掌握这一领域的技术。

1. 敏感信息处理

1.1 移除API密钥

在开发过程中,有时需要移除仓库中的API密钥,以防止其被推送到GitHub。以下是具体步骤:
1. 清理Git历史记录。
2. 再次强制推送:

git push origin --force –all

需要注意的是,清理Git历史记录后,所有克隆过该仓库的人都需要重新克隆或进行强制拉取。

1.2 解决电子邮件隐私相关问题

有时候,可能会遇到与电子邮件隐私相关的错误消息,提示GitHub因电子邮件隐私限制而阻止推送。这可能是因为GitHub试图保护隐私,不允许使用私人电子邮件地址的提交推送到公共仓库。以下是解决此问题的方法:

使用GitHub提供的无回复电子邮件地址
  1. 配置Git使用GitHub提供的无回复电子邮件地址:
    • 访问GitHub并登录您的账户。
    • 转到“Settings” -> “Emails”。
    • 查找类似于“Keep my email address private. We will use yourusername@users.noreply.github.c
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值